What is Blockchain Technology?

Blockchain technology is a decentralized digital ledger system that records transactions across many computers. This ensures that the recorded transactions cannot be altered retroactively, providing enhanced security, transparency, and trust. Each block in the blockchain contains a number of transactions, and every time a new transaction occurs, it is added to the ledger in a way that is immutable and tamper-resistant.

One of the key features of blockchain technology is its consensus mechanism, which allows participating nodes to agree on the validity of transactions. Popular consensus models include Proof of Work (PoW) and Proof of Stake (PoS). These mechanisms play a crucial role in maintaining the integrity and security of the network.

In the cryptocurrency market, blockchain serves as the backbone for cryptocurrencies such as Bitcoin and Ethereum. It enables peer-to-peer transactions without the need for intermediaries, which can reduce costs and improve transaction speed. Each cryptocurrency operates on its own specific blockchain, tailored to its features and requirements.

Blockchain technology is not limited to cryptocurrency; it has potential applications in various sectors, including supply chain management, healthcare, and finance. Its ability to provide a secure, transparent, and efficient way to record and transfer data positions it as a game-changer in many industries.
